stdClass Object ( [year] => 2008 [artist] => Gregory Maguire [fiction] => 1 [coverImageUrl] => https://cover.hoopladigital.com/hpc_9780061762833_270.jpeg [titleId] => 11587485 [isbn] => 9780061762833 [abridged] => [language] => ENGLISH [profanity] => [title] => Mirror Mirror [demo] => [segments] => Array ( ) [duration] => 9h 5m 17s [children] => [artists] => Array ( [0] => stdClass Object ( [name] => Gregory Maguire [artistFormal] => Maguire, Gregory [relationship] => AUTHOR ) [1] => stdClass Object ( [name] => John McDonough [artistFormal] => McDonough, John [relationship] => READER ) ) [genres] => Array ( [0] => Fiction ) [price] => 2.99 [id] => 11587485 [edited] => [kind] => AUDIOBOOK [active] => 1 [upc] => [synopsis] => The year is 1502, and seven-year-old Bianca de Nevada lives perched high above the rolling hills and valleys of Tuscany and Umbria at Montefiore, the farm of her beloved father, Don Vincente. But one day a noble entourage makes its way up the winding slopes to the farm-and the world comes to Montefiore. In the presence of Cesare Borgia and his sister, the lovely and vain Lucrezia-decadent children of a wicked pope-no one can claim innocence for long. When Borgia sends Don Vicente on a years-long quest to reclaim a relic of the original Tree of Knowledge, he leaves Bianca under the care-so to speak-of Lucrezia. She plots a dire fate for the young girl in the woods below the farm, but in the dark forest there can be found salvation as well . . . The eye is always caught by light, but shadows have more to say. [url] => https://www.hoopladigital.com/title/11587485 [pa] => [publisher] => HarperAudio [purchaseModel] => INSTANT )
